The table below provides summary statistics and salary benchmarking for jobs advertised in England requiring Photoshop skills. It covers permanent job vacancies from the 6 months leading up to 1 April 2026, with comparisons to the same periods in the previous two years.

6 months to
1 Apr 2026
Same period 2025 Same period 2024
Rank 594 514 551
Rank change year-on-year -80 +37 +170
Permanent jobs citing Photoshop 64 95 269
As % of all permanent jobs in England 0.091% 0.26% 0.34%
As % of the Applications category 1.47% 2.32% 3.41%
Number of salaries quoted 43 29 212
10th Percentile £26,811 £26,500 £23,800
25th Percentile £29,777 £27,500 £26,250
Median annual salary (50th Percentile) £40,000 £35,000 £30,000
Median % change year-on-year +14.29% +16.67% -33.33%
75th Percentile £52,500 £48,750 £39,500
90th Percentile £64,550 £51,000 £45,000
UK median annual salary £40,000 £43,750 £30,000
% change year-on-year -8.57% +45.83% -33.33%
